Yoga styles

Hatha Yoga and Vinyasa Yoga classes are offered according to your preference:

Hatha Yoga: accessible to all (beginners or intermediates), this gentle class aims to restore balance to the body and a sense of inner well-being, while loosening the body to the rhythm of the breath. Each session is divided into three parts: warm-up, postures (safe and adapted as required) and a period of deep relaxation to activate the parasympathetic system (stress management).

Vinyasa Yoga: this class offers dynamic movements in synchronization with the breath, strengthening and stretching all the muscles of the body to help you relax after a long day’s work. Each session is divided into three parts: the warm-up, the postures (safe and adapted to your needs) and the guided relaxation period to activate your parasympathetic system (stress management).
